&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Quick Answer:&lt;/strong&gt; Holiday weekend towing in Atlanta costs $150-400+ depending on distance and company. Expect 25-50% surge pricing above normal rates. AAA members pay less, but wait times stretch 2-4 hours during peak holiday travel.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;/blockquote&gt;
&lt;h2 id="what-youll-pay"&gt;What You&amp;rsquo;ll Pay&lt;/h2&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Base towing rates in Atlanta:&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Local tow (under 5 miles): $100-150 normally, $125-200 on holidays&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Medium distance (5-20 miles): $150-250 normally, $200-350 on holidays&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Long haul (20+ miles): $200-350 normally, $300-500+ on holidays&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Holiday surcharges add 25-50% to base rates.&lt;/strong&gt; Memorial Day, July 4th, Labor Day, Thanksgiving, and Christmas weekend hit hardest.&lt;/p&gt;</description></item><item><title>Towing Cost in Phoenix Arizona After Hours: What You'll Pay</title><link>https://towwiththeflow.com/towing-cost-phoenix-arizona-after-hours/</link><pubDate>Tue, 07 Apr 2026 00:00:00 +0000</pubDate><guid>https://towwiththeflow.com/towing-cost-phoenix-arizona-after-hours/</guid><description>&lt;blockquote&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Quick Answer:&lt;/strong&gt; After hours towing in Phoenix typically costs $150-300 base rate plus $3-7 per mile. Weekend and holiday rates run highest. Expect 20-50% surcharges over daytime rates. Call multiple companies for quotes since prices vary significantly.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;/blockquote&gt;
&lt;h2 id="what-to-do"&gt;What To Do&lt;/h2&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Call your insurance first&lt;/strong&gt; - Many policies include roadside assistance that covers towing up to certain limits&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Get quotes from 3-4 companies&lt;/strong&gt; - Prices vary wildly, especially after hours&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Ask about total cost upfront&lt;/strong&gt; - Base rate plus mileage plus any surcharges&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Confirm your exact location&lt;/strong&gt; - Use GPS coordinates or nearby landmarks&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Ask for estimated arrival time&lt;/strong&gt; - After hours service can take 45-90 minutes&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Have payment ready&lt;/strong&gt; - Most require credit card or cash on scene&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Take photos&lt;/strong&gt; if accident-related - Before tow truck moves your vehicle&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Quick Answer:&lt;/strong&gt; Sunday tow rates run $75-150+ due to weekend premiums. Call multiple local operators, check AAA membership, search &amp;ldquo;24/7 tow&amp;rdquo; on Google Maps, and avoid highway predators who charge $200-400. Independent shops often beat big chains on Sunday pricing.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;/blockquote&gt;
&lt;h2 id="what-to-do"&gt;What To Do&lt;/h2&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Search Google Maps for &amp;ldquo;24/7 tow truck&amp;rdquo;&lt;/strong&gt; - Filter by currently open, call at least 3 shops&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Check your insurance roadside coverage&lt;/strong&gt; - Many policies include free towing up to 15 miles&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Call AAA if you&amp;rsquo;re a member&lt;/strong&gt; - Sunday rates same as weekdays, typically $50-100 total&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Ask for flat rate pricing upfront&lt;/strong&gt; - Get mileage rate and any Sunday surcharges in writing&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Try independent operators first&lt;/strong&gt; - Small local shops often charge less than big chains&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Avoid highway &amp;ldquo;vultures&amp;rdquo;&lt;/strong&gt; - Don&amp;rsquo;t accept unsolicited help from trucks that just show up&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Get pickup and destination addresses confirmed&lt;/strong&gt; - Prevents surprise mileage charges&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
